Advantages of Aluminium Doors
Aluminium doors provide a wide variety of benefits that make them a clever investment for residential and commercial properties. A few of the notable advantages consist of:
Durability: Aluminium does not warp, rot, or rust quickly, offering an enduring option that can hold up against the components without substantial wear or tear.
Energy Efficiency: Modern aluminium doors frequently include thermal breaks, which can assist enhance energy efficiency and minimize heating expenses.
Style Versatility: With a vast array of designs, surfaces, and colors, aluminium doors can be personalized to fit the visual of any home or service.
Low Maintenance: Unlike wooden doors that need regular painting or staining, aluminium doors just need occasional cleaning to maintain their appearance.
Security: Aluminium doors are solid and robust, supplying excellent resistance against required entry, thus enhancing the security of the property.

Step-by-Step Guide to Fitting Aluminium Doors
Fitting Aluminium Doors (oxsoil3.Werite.net) is a careful job that requires mindful planning and execution. Follow these actions to make sure an effective installation:
Step 1: Measure the Door Opening
- Width: Measure the width of the door frame at the top, middle, and bottom.

- Diagonal: Measure diagonally from corner to corner to ensure the frame is square.
Step 2: Choose Your Door
Select an aluminium door that fits the measurements you've taken. Think about the door's design and thermal efficiency functions.
Action 3: Prepare the Door Frame
- Examine the door frame for any damage or rot.
- Use a level to guarantee the frame is plumb.
- Tidy the location where the door will be installed to eliminate debris.
Step 4: Install the Frame
- Place the aluminium frame into the opening and change it for level and plumb.
- Mark the position of the depend upon the frame.
- Attach the frame to the wall with screws, guaranteeing it is secure.
Step 5: Fit the Door
- Insert the door into the frame and align it with the hinges.
- Use a screwdriver to attach the hinges safely to the frame.
- Examine the positioning of the door; it should open and close smoothly.
Step 6: Install Hardware
- Attach the door manage, latch, and any other locking systems as per the producer's instructions.
- Evaluate all hardware for proper performance.
Step 7: Seal and Finish
- Utilize an ideal sealant around the frame to guarantee it is watertight.
- Examine the door for any spaces and fill them with insulation or gasket material if needed.
- Clean the door to get rid of any dust or finger prints, and perform a final examination.
By following these actions, house owners can ensure their brand-new aluminium doors are fitted effectively, supplying both security and aesthetic appeal.
Frequently Asked Questions about Fitting Aluminium Doors
Q1: How long does it take to fit an aluminium door?

Q2: Do I require a professional for fitting aluminium doors?
A: While experienced DIYers can effectively fit an aluminium door on their own, hiring a professional is advisable to ensure appropriate installation, especially for complicated styles or larger doors.
Q3: Are aluminium doors energy-efficient?
A: Yes, modern aluminium doors frequently feature thermal breaks that increase energy efficiency by lowering heat transfer, making them an excellent option for energy-conscious house owners.
Q4: How do I maintain my aluminium doors?
A: Aluminium doors need minimal upkeep. Regularly inspect seals and hinges, and clean the surface area with moderate cleaning agent and water to keep them looking new.
Q5: Can I paint my aluminium door?
A: While you can paint aluminium doors, it's advised to utilize an ideal primer and paint designed for metal surfaces to ensure excellent adhesion and appearance.
